4 connectionsΒ·4 entities in this videoβTony Blair's Role in Gaza Peace Plan
- π‘ Tony Blair is seen as a credible figure for the Gaza peace plan due to his unwavering commitment to peace in the Middle East over the past 20 years.
- π― Rice recalls that Blair could access Gaza when she, as the American Secretary of State, could not, highlighting his established relationships and access.
President Trump's Involvement
- πΊπΈ Having President Trump involved lends significant weight and indicates that the United States backs the initiative.
- β The specific composition of the transitional group and its charter are yet to be determined, but Trump's direct involvement is noted.
A Step-by-Step Approach to Peace
- π£ Rice emphasizes the importance of taking one step at a time, referencing Hillary Clinton's advice, to ensure progress rather than getting lost in long-term visions.
- β The focus is on the first step of the 20-point plan holding, followed by subsequent steps, contingent on continued commitment from all parties.
Celebrating a Potential Ceasefire
- π Rice expresses personal celebration for the potential ceasefire in Gaza, acknowledging the immense humanitarian cost of the war.
- π The ongoing conflict has resulted in suffering for hostages, Palestinians, and Israelis who have feared for their security.
